How to register

We have an open list and welcome requests for registration from patients living in or moving to the practice area.

To register with the practice:

Registering at the Practice

Patients who have permanently moved into the Practice area can register with the Practice and will be required to provide proof of address and photo identification as this will be required for online services which you will find in your registration information pack.

If you have registered with the practice previously and moved away, you will be required to complete a Temporary Resident form – please ask at reception for the form.

If you are staying with a relative for 1 week or more you can register with the Practice as a Temporary Resident – please ask at reception for the form. Temporary Resident Forms are only available from reception.

We are not able to carryout Travel Vaccinations for Temporary Residents; this is due to the Practice not having the full Patient Record. You are advised to attend your Registered GP Practice or the Travel Clinic.

We recommend that new patients undertake a health check with a Health Care Assistant.
